Understanding Customer Expectations for Repairs

auto repair workshop

In the realm of customer satisfaction, especially within the automotive sector, understanding and managing repair expectations is a game-changer. Repair expectations management (REM) is a strategic approach that focuses on setting and fulfilling customer expectations for vehicle repairs, be it a simple fender bender or intricate luxury vehicle paint repair. The key lies in recognizing that each customer brings with them a unique set of expectations, shaped by past experiences, personal preferences, and industry perceptions. For instance, a regular car owner might prioritize swift fixes while a luxury vehicle enthusiast may demand meticulous attention to detail in every aspect from vehicle body repair to paint consistency.

REM involves a multi-faceted process that begins with active listening and clear communication. Mechanics and service centers must inquire about the customer’s expectations, desired timeline, and specific areas of concern, whether it’s aesthetics (like a flawless luxury vehicle paint repair) or functionality. This information enables them to tailor their approach, ensuring transparency throughout. For example, a specialized luxury vehicle repair shop could assure clients that while a complete body kit replacement takes time, they employ advanced techniques for precise color matching during the repaint process.

Strategies to Set Realistic Repair Timeframes

auto repair workshop

Setting realistic repair timeframes is a cornerstone of effective repair expectations management, a strategy that significantly enhances customer satisfaction across various vehicle repair sectors, from autobody repairs to hail damage restoration and even luxury vehicle maintenance. The key lies in balancing customer expectations with operational capabilities. Studies show that clear communication regarding turnaround times can reduce customer anxiety and improve post-repair satisfaction levels by up to 20%.

For instance, a reputable body shop specializing in hail damage repair should not only promise quick repairs but also be transparent about the intricate processes involved in assessing and fixing each unique damage pattern. By providing a realistic timeframe for each step—from initial inspection to painting and final quality check—the shop demonstrates professionalism and respect for its customers’ time. This approach fosters trust, especially when dealing with urgent matters like hail storms that can leave a fleet of vehicles in need of immediate attention.

Implementing robust systems for estimating repair times is crucial. Utilizing digital tools tailored for specific vehicle types (e.g., luxury cars) allows technicians to input data more efficiently, minimizing estimation errors and delays. For example, a specialized software platform might account for the unique materials and intricate finishes found in high-end vehicles, providing a more accurate estimate for restoration work. This not only sets realistic expectations but also ensures consistent quality across different repair scenarios.

Regular reviews of estimated versus actual repair times are essential to continually refine expectations management strategies. Data-driven insights can highlight trends, areas for improvement, and best practices within the organization. Communicating Progress: Enhancing Satisfaction Through Transparency

auto repair workshop

In the realm of auto body repairs and luxury vehicle repair services, effective repair expectations management is a powerful tool to elevate customer satisfaction. Communicating progress transparently is a strategic approach that fosters trust and empowers clients during what can often be a stressful experience. This method has been shown to significantly enhance client experiences, encouraging repeat business and positive word-of-mouth referrals.

When auto body shops and repair facilities implement robust repair expectations management practices, they set the stage for success. By keeping customers informed about each step of the repair process—from initial assessment to final inspection—shops create an environment of transparency. For instance, a luxury vehicle owner bringing their car in for repairs can receive regular updates on parts availability, estimated turnaround times, and the progress of specific tasks. This level of detail reassures clients that their vehicle is in capable hands. A study by J.D. Power found that transparent communication during auto body repairs increased customer satisfaction ratings by 20%.

Moreover, providing real-time updates allows repair shops to address any concerns promptly. If a delay occurs, customers are apprised of the situation and offered alternative solutions or timelines. This proactive approach diffuses potential frustrations and demonstrates a commitment to customer service excellence. For example, a shop might use text updates or mobile apps to notify clients when their car is ready, including an estimate of time taken for final quality checks—a simple yet effective strategy that leaves a lasting impression.
